    Wondering about the weather during the end of May ?? Is it hot enough to go to a water park ??

    Hi Clara,

    Pack your swimsuit and sunscreen because May is a great time to hit Disney's Blizzard Beach, Typhoon Lagoon and the pools at your resort.  The average highs in May are typically in the upper 80s and average lows are in the mid-60s.  

    Along with your swimwear, I'd also pack an umbrella and ponchos.  It is common for rain showers in central Florida in the Spring.

    About ten days prior to your trip, go to www.weather.com and look at the 10-day forecast just in case there is some out of the ordinary weather pattern is moving through.
